Hi guys!

I need your help: I'm currently mining with Nicehash miner, but I realized that the coin it mine is not the most profitable.
I want to mine Equihash only, but on websites like whattomine it appears that Zencash is the most profitable, instead of Zcash.
The problem is that I don't find a miner for that coin, neither a wallet. Maybe I'm missing something...

Can you please give me some advice?
P.S. I've 3x1070

I've been mining zencash on and off for a while. I wouldn't recommend using the pool zenmine pro. I mined there for about 3 days and even though it has zero percent pool fee, I seemed to get a lower mining rate there than other pools like suprnova. If you check out the zencash announcements thread you'll notice a couple people have said the same thing. It might just be variance since as zenmine is a bit smaller but up to you.

Also on how to mine zencash, there is an instruction on the suprnova site under help on the zencash sub section. Very similar to mining zcash just need to change a few commands.
